Friday's Broadcast Ratings: FOX Rides World Series to Top Spot
By The Futon Critic Staff (TFC)

Primetime Preliminary Fast National Nielsen Data
(includes all DVR playback through 3:00 am)

Here are the highlights of the 14 ad-sustained programs that aired in primetime on the broadcast networks last night (10/30/15):

FOX (12.508 million viewers, #1; adults 18-49: 3.1, #1) was the network to beat on Friday with its coverage of the "World Series, Game 3" (12.508 million viewers, #1; adults 18-49: 3.1, #1).

ABC (6.852 million viewers, #3; adults 18-49: 1.4, #2) then had to settle for second place with its mix of "Last Man Standing" (6.841 million viewers, #5; adults 18-49: 1.2, #T4), "Dr. Ken" (5.783 million viewers, #8; adults 18-49: 1.2, #T4), "Shark Tank" (6.085 million viewers, #7; adults 18-49: 1.4, #3) and "20/20" (8.158 million viewers, #3; adults 18-49: 1.7, #2).

Next up was CBS (7.921 million viewers, #2; adults 18-49: 1.1, #3) and its trio of "The Amazing Race" (6.096 million viewers, #6; adults 18-49: 1.2, #T4), "Hawaii Five-0" (8.128 million viewers, #4; adults 18-49: 1.1, #T7) and "Blue Bloods" (9.540 million viewers, #2; adults 18-49: 1.1, #T7).

Meanwhile, NBC (3.256 million viewers, #4; adults 18-49: 0.9, #4) offered up new episodes of "Undateable" (2.652 million viewers, #11; adults 18-49: 0.7, #T11) and "Truth Be Told" (2.326 million viewers, #12; adults 18-49: 0.7, #T11), the return of "Grimm" (3.967 million viewers, #9; adults 18-49: 1.1, #T7) and a new "Dateline NBC" (3.314 million viewers, #10; adults 18-49: 0.8, #10).

And finally, repeat "Crazy Ex-Girlfriend" (0.787 million viewers, #14; adults 18-49: 0.2, #T13) and a new "America's Next Top Model" (0.939 million viewers, #13; adults 18-49: 0.2, #T13) on The CW (0.863 million viewers, #5; adults 18-49: 0.2, #5) closed out the night.
